POLITICS

-With 99.45% of votes counted in the country’s parliamentary elections, the ruling Social Democratic Party (PSD) won 22.6% of votes. The Alliance for the Union of Romanians (AUR) was in second place, with 18.2%, and the National Liberal party (PNL), the Social Democrats’ coalition ally in Romania’s outgoing government, in third on 14.4%. SOS and POT, had 7.6% and 6.3%, respectively, and the ethnic Hungarian Party UDMR got 6.5%.

-Romanian President Klaus Iohannis promulgates a law saying shareholders can participate, vote in general meetings online, by mail. “Shareholders, in person or represented, can participate and vote physically or by electronic means of distance communication in general meetings. They can also express their vote by mail,” the normative act which amends and supplements the Companies Law no. 31/1990 states.

ECONOMY

-Romania’s unemployment rate stood at 5.4% in October 2024, decreasing by 0.2 percentage points compared to September 2024, the National Institute of Statistics (INS) data showed.

-The Ministry of Finance on Monday attracted 710.3 million RON from banks, issuing a benchmark government bond with a residual maturity of 53 months, at an average yield of 7.17%, the National Bank of Romania (BNR) data showed.

-Several editors of print media are complaining about the unilateral increase, without consultation, by the management of the Romanian Post Office, of the commissions collected for the distribution of printed newspapers, according to a statement sent to News.ro and signed by the representatives of 17 local newspapers.

FINANCE

-American investment firm Franklin Templeton, which has been managing Romanian fund Fondul Proprietatea since 2010, has announced it decided to it would not seek a new term as the Fund’s manager. The firm will therefore not submit a response to the request for proposal (RFP) to the selection advisor, Deutsche Numis.

-On 30 November 2024, the National Bank of Romania’s foreign exchange reserves stood at EUR 61,174 million, compared to EUR 62,841 million on 31 October 2024. The gold stock remained steady at 103.6 tonnes. However, following the change in the international price of gold, its value amounted to EUR 8,399 million.

COMPANIES

-The Dutch shipbuilding company Damen, which acquired a 49% stake in Romania’s Mangalia shipyard in 2018, and the Romanian state-owned company 2MMS agreed to terminate their association contract for the shared operation of the shipyard (Santierul Naval 2 Mai) on the Black Sea coast of Romania. The shipyard filed for a bankruptcy proceeding at the end of May. Damen has a long history with Romania operating the Galati shipyard since 1999.

-GLO Marine, a Romanian naval architecture and consulting company, announced the opening of a new office in Bucharest, a hub dedicated to naval engineering with a focus on sustainability projects. The company oversees every stage of the vessel modernization process and is now one of the few providers in Europe offering comprehensive retrofit solutions.

CAPITAL MARKET COMMENTARY

Bucharest stocks traded in the green on Monday rebounding off last week’s sell-off. The benchmark BET index, which tracks the performance of the 20 most liquid companies, closed up 0.63%. Iasi-based drug maker Antibiotice led the blue-chip gainers, surging 4.76%.
